1. What are the Advantages of Using LED Lights?
LED lights offer numerous advantages over traditional lighting options, making them a preferred choice for many contractors. One of the most significant benefits is energy efficiency. LEDs consume significantly less power compared to incandescent and fluorescent lights, leading to lower electricity bills for clients.
Another advantage is their longevity. LED lights have a much longer lifespan, often lasting up to 25,000 hours or more. This reduces the frequency of replacements, which can save both time and money for contractors and their clients alike.
Durability and Environmental Impact
LEDs are also more durable than traditional bulbs. They are made from solid materials, making them resistant to breakage and ideal for various applications, including outdoor and industrial settings. Additionally, LEDs do not contain harmful substances like mercury, which is found in fluorescent lights, making them a more environmentally friendly option.
Moreover, the robust construction of LED lights means they can withstand extreme temperatures and vibrations, making them suitable for use in demanding environments, such as warehouses and manufacturing facilities. This durability not only enhances safety but also contributes to a more sustainable approach to lighting, as fewer replacements mean less waste and lower environmental impact over time.
Quality of Light
In terms of light quality, LEDs provide excellent color rendering and can be designed to emit a wide range of colors. This versatility allows contractors to create customized lighting solutions that meet the specific needs of their clients, enhancing both aesthetics and functionality.
Furthermore, LED technology enables the production of lights that can be dimmed or adjusted to different color temperatures, allowing for dynamic lighting schemes that can transform a space. For instance, warm white LEDs can create a cozy atmosphere in residential settings, while cooler white lights are ideal for workspaces that require focus and concentration. This adaptability not only enhances the user experience but also allows for innovative design possibilities in both commercial and residential projects.
2. How Do LED Lights Compare to Other Lighting Technologies?
When comparing LED lights to other technologies such as incandescent, fluorescent, and halogen lights, several factors come into play. While incandescent bulbs are known for their warm light, they are highly inefficient, converting much of their energy into heat rather than light. In contrast, LEDs produce very little heat, making them safer and more efficient. This efficiency not only contributes to lower energy consumption but also extends the lifespan of the bulbs, with many LEDs lasting up to 25,000 hours or more compared to the 1,000 hours typical of incandescent bulbs.
Fluorescent lights, while more efficient than incandescent bulbs, still fall short of the performance offered by LEDs. They often require a warm-up period and can flicker, which may be undesirable in certain settings. Additionally, fluorescent lights contain mercury, which poses environmental concerns during disposal. LEDs, on the other hand, provide instant brightness and are available in various color temperatures, allowing for greater flexibility in design. This adaptability makes them suitable for a wide range of applications, from residential spaces to commercial environments, enhancing both functionality and aesthetics.
Cost Considerations
Although the initial cost of LED lights may be higher than traditional options, the long-term savings on energy bills and maintenance costs make them a more economical choice. Many contractors find that clients are willing to invest in LEDs due to the overall value they provide over time. In fact, the energy efficiency of LEDs can lead to savings of up to 80% on electricity costs, making them an attractive option for both homeowners and businesses looking to reduce their carbon footprint. Furthermore, the durability of LEDs means fewer replacements, which translates to lower labor costs for installation and maintenance.

3. What are the Common Applications for LED Lights?
LED lights are incredibly versatile and can be used in a wide range of applications. From residential settings to commercial and industrial environments, the possibilities are virtually limitless. In residential applications, LEDs are commonly used for task lighting, accent lighting, and general illumination.
In commercial settings, LED lights are often found in retail spaces, offices, and hospitality venues. Their ability to provide bright, energy-efficient lighting makes them ideal for enhancing visibility and creating inviting atmospheres. Additionally, many businesses are now incorporating smart LED systems that allow for remote control and automation, further increasing efficiency.
Outdoor and Landscape Lighting
Outdoor lighting is another area where LEDs shine. They are perfect for illuminating pathways, gardens, and architectural features, providing safety and enhancing aesthetics. With their durability and resistance to weather conditions, LEDs are an excellent choice for landscape lighting.
Industrial Applications
In industrial settings, LED lights are used for warehouse lighting, manufacturing facilities, and even street lighting. Their long lifespan and low maintenance requirements make them particularly appealing for businesses looking to reduce operational costs.
4. How Do You Choose the Right LED Light for a Project?
Selecting the appropriate LED light for a project involves several considerations. First and foremost, understanding the specific requirements of the space is crucial. Factors such as the size of the area, the purpose of the lighting, and the desired ambiance will influence the choice of LED products.
Contractors should also consider the color temperature of the LED lights. Measured in Kelvin (K), color temperature affects the mood and functionality of a space. For example, warmer tones (around 2700K) are often preferred for residential settings, while cooler tones (5000K and above) are suitable for commercial and industrial applications.
Wattage and Lumens
Another important aspect to consider is the wattage and lumens of the LED lights. Lumens measure the brightness of the light, while wattage indicates energy consumption. Contractors should aim for a balance between sufficient brightness and energy efficiency to meet the needs of their clients.
Compatibility with Existing Systems
Lastly, compatibility with existing lighting systems is essential. Many contractors encounter situations where they need to retrofit LED lights into older fixtures. Understanding the compatibility of LED products with existing systems can help avoid potential issues and ensure a smooth installation process.
5. What are the Installation Considerations for LED Lights?
Installing LED lights may differ from traditional lighting systems, and contractors should be aware of several key considerations. First, ensuring proper wiring and connections is vital. LED lights operate at lower voltages, and using the correct wiring can prevent issues such as flickering or reduced performance.
Additionally, the placement of LED lights should be carefully planned. Factors such as the height of the fixtures, spacing between lights, and the direction of the light beam can affect the overall effectiveness of the lighting design. Contractors should take the time to assess the space and create a lighting plan that maximizes the benefits of LED technology.
Heat Management
Heat management is another critical aspect of LED installation. While LEDs generate less heat than traditional bulbs, they still require proper ventilation to maintain optimal performance. Ensuring that fixtures are designed to dissipate heat effectively can prolong the lifespan of the lights and prevent potential issues.
Compliance with Regulations
Lastly, contractors should be familiar with local building codes and regulations regarding lighting installations. Compliance with these guidelines is essential to ensure safety and avoid potential legal issues. Staying informed about any changes in regulations can help contractors provide the best service to their clients.
6. What Maintenance is Required for LED Lights?
One of the significant advantages of LED lights is their low maintenance requirements. Unlike traditional bulbs that may need frequent replacements, LEDs can last for years with minimal upkeep. However, some maintenance practices can help ensure their longevity and optimal performance.
Regular cleaning of LED fixtures is essential, especially in commercial and industrial settings where dust and grime can accumulate. Keeping the lights clean will enhance their brightness and efficiency. Additionally, contractors should periodically check for any signs of damage or wear, ensuring that all fixtures are functioning correctly.
Upgrading Systems
As technology continues to evolve, contractors should also consider upgrading older LED systems to take advantage of advancements in efficiency and performance. This may involve replacing older fixtures with newer models that offer better energy savings and improved light quality.
Client Education
Educating clients about the benefits of LED lighting and proper usage can also contribute to the longevity of the installation. Providing guidance on how to use dimmers, timers, and smart controls can enhance the overall experience and satisfaction with the lighting system.
